FAQ

Q: What is Form CR-2A?A: Form CR-2A is a declaration used to obtain the services of court-appointed counsel in the County of San Mateo, California.

Q: What is the purpose of Form CR-2A?A: The purpose of Form CR-2A is to declare under penalty of perjury that the individual is financially unable to afford the services of an attorney and requires court-appointed counsel.

Q: Who can use Form CR-2A?A: Individuals who are facing criminal charges in the County of San Mateo, California and cannot afford an attorney may use Form CR-2A to request court-appointed counsel.

Q: Are there any fees associated with Form CR-2A?A: No, there are no fees associated with Form CR-2A.

Q: What should be included in the declaration?A: The declaration should include information about the individual's financial status, including income, assets, and expenses, to demonstrate their inability to afford an attorney.

Q: What happens after submitting Form CR-2A?A: After submitting Form CR-2A, the court will review the declaration and determine if the individual qualifies for court-appointed counsel.

Q: Can the court-appointed counsel be changed later?A: Yes, in certain circumstances, the court-appointed counsel can be changed later, but it requires approval from the court.

Q: What if I do not qualify for court-appointed counsel?A: If you do not qualify for court-appointed counsel, you may need to seek alternative options, such as hiring a private attorney or exploring pro bonolegal services.
